摘 要:以淮稻11号和甬优2640为材料,研究了基蘖肥与穗肥不同比例对钵苗机插稻产量及产量构成的影响。结果表明,基蘖肥与穗肥比例为7∶3或6∶4时,2个品种穗粒结构协调性好;群体茎蘖消长平稳,最终成穗率达70%以上,并能增加中后期群体叶面积指数和干物质积累,最终实产明显高于其他比例处理。The effects of nitrogen application ratio on yield and yield formation of pot-seedling mechanical transplanting rice were studied in this paper, with Huaidao 11 and Yongyou 2640 as materials. The results showed that the relation between panicle and grains, and the yield were better than other treatments, when the basal fertilizer and panicle fertilizer ratio is 7 ∶3 or 6∶4. The population tillers were growing and declining steadily, the spike rates were above 70%, the leaf area index and biomass increased with the treatments of 7∶3 or 6∶4 in the middle and late growth stage.
